A probe team that looked into the vandalism of the Salt Lake Stadium during an event featuring Argentine football icon Lionel Messi has suggested a Special Investigation Team (SIT) to carry out an elaborate investigation into the incident, an official told the media on Tuesday. The committee presented its first report as early as Monday, only three days after it was constituted.
The panel is led by former judge Justice Asim Kumar Roy and also comprised of Chief Secretary Manoj Pant and Home Secretary Nandini Chakraborty. It was established on the instructions of West Bengal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ee after unrests were reported in the stadium when Messi was visiting Kolkata on December 13.
The incident, according to the committee members, demands a thorough investigation, which is independent and is aimed at identifying responsibility and lack of procedures in a clear manner. The initial investigations have raised red flags of serious breaches of standard operating procedures especially in the areas of security in the stadium and management of crowds.
The existence of water bottles within the stadium is one of the major issues that have been mentioned in the report. According to the current laws, visitors cannot enter the stadiums with water bottles. The committee enquired on how the water bottles were sold within the stadium and also, stalls that sold water had been reportedly put up within the podium, which is a strong violation of the accepted norms.
On Tuesday, Justice Roy, in responding to a press conference, noted that such arrangements were very unusual and needed close consideration. He emphasized the importance of investigating any deviation of safety procedures particularly in the high profile events.
The committee has suggested a departmental measure against the agency involved in the operations and management of stadiums where the committee said that it was not possible to prove accountability without detecting failure by the relevant authorities. It also proposed the commencement of respective departmental actions on those officials who are guilty.
